Travelers to Catania should stay alert to typical urban risks (pickpocketing, traffic) and follow local guidance when engaging in hiking or adventure sports on Mount Etna. Emergency services are available, and standard health precautions apply.

Climate normals · 2016–2025
When to go: Catania month by month
Judged purely on 2016–2025 weather records, the friendliest months in Catania are typically April, May and October, with average daytime highs around 20–24°C. July is usually the warmest month (average high 33°C), January the coldest (average low 8°C), and October the wettest (about 101 mm). These are long-run averages, not a forecast.
| Month | Avg high (°C) | Avg low (°C) | Rain (mm) | Sunshine (h/day)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| 15.1 | 7.7 | 55 | 8.3 |
| February | 16.1 | 8.3 | 64 | 8.8 |
| March | 17.6 | 9.6 | 63 | 9.9 |
| April | 19.9 | 12.0 | 29 | 10.7 |
| May | 23.7 | 15.6 | 44 | 12.2 |
| June | 29.4 | 20.7 | 18 | 13.4 |
| July | 32.6 | 23.5 | 6 | 13.9 |
| August | 32.3 | 23.8 | 10 | 12.6 |
| September | 28.7 | 21.0 | 40 | 10.9 |
| October | 24.4 | 17.0 | 101 | 9.4 |
| November | 20.1 | 13.4 | 90 | 8.0 |
| December | 16.5 | 9.6 | 48 | 7.8 |

01 · Q&AWhere is Catania located and what are its coordinates?
Catania is situated in Italy at geographic coordinates 37.4922, 15.0704 with an elevation of 7 meters above sea level.
02 · Q&AWhat is the population and time zone of Catania?
Catania has a recorded population of approximately 311,584 and observes the Europe/Rome time zone (EUR).
